MONTE CARLO METHODS IN PROTEIN RECURRENT DESIGN
Alina BUŢU*, Marian BUŢU**
* National Institute of Research and Development for Biological Sciences, Bucharest
** GRS COMMUNICATION, Bucharest

Abstract. In this work we present a novel approach to the protein design problem, our principal contribution being the ability to specify the degree of accuracy desired in the solution set. We achieve this by replacing the exhaustive search steps of the original recursive design algorithm with Monte Carlo sampling of conformation space. A modification to the recursive design of proteins in the 2D-HP model is made, this algorithm finds supersets of the solution set, and by varying parameters can minimize the size of this superset to any desired accuracy.
